Load cells are critical components in industries ranging from manufacturing and construction to healthcare and aerospace. These devices convert force, weight, or pressure into measurable electrical signals, making them indispensable for precision measurements. However, selecting the right load cell for your application starts with understanding its data sheet—a document packed with technical specifications, performance metrics, and operational details.
